No one except big software companies with 1000's of employess can DEVELOP those softwares ...
See most of the guys who create such projects use SDK
If u know Visual Basic and have Speech SDK,u can design the program itself.
First u have to download the MS Speech SDK
Their is an excellent Speech SDK Doc's which will help u
__________________
If the Start Windows Restart when Windows starts check box is checked Windows Restart will start automatically every time Windows is started. - Actual excerpt from a windows program help file